The XtremepowerUS 60 in. Recessed In-Wall Smokeless Electric FireplAce with 3 Changeable Flame Color offers a simplistic and beautiful wall mount/built-in fireplAce option to enhance your indoor living spAce. This recessed in-wall electric fireplAce features two heat settings operation from low to high settings to accommodate cold weather season or the freezing cold winter; boasting 5,100 BTU to heat up any kind of room up to 400 sq. ft. This electric fireplAce is specially designed for in-wall installation, it has vents on the front of the fireplAce so that it can be recessed into the wall; can be mounted under TV. The dual heat settings control the heat output from the fireplAce and can be adjusted for optimal heat intensity of energy saving mode. No gas, ethanol, propane or gel cans required. Save time and energy as this fireplAce produces no messy or harmful byproducts, so there’s no need to clean flake of soot or ashes, gas or oil. Worry not about it being dangerous to small children or pets, since this electric fireplAce unit can be used wall-mounted or flush-mounted into the wall.

Trying to distill WWll down to a little over 400 pages is a Herculean task but Mr. Kennedy does a serviceable job. He provides thumbnail sketches of the major players' personalities and tics. He does an admirable job of jumping back and forth between the European and Pacific theaters of operation, always keeping in mind America's POV in explaining how FDR and his staff dealt with their fractious, troublesome allies. He explains how the Rosie the riveter myth is pretty much a fabrication and how America's approach to manufacturing was able to out produce the German mode of war production: America going for Quantity vs. the German fixation with Quality. Lots interesting information and facts. There are areas where I thought he could have used more depth such as the death of FDR (probably no more than two pages.if that); Mussolini and Hitler's last hours are given mere paragraphs; Churchill being voted out of office just months shy of victory in Europe is given maybe two paragraphs and while he mentions how Tibetts went to the airplane factory to pick the future Enola Gay off the assembly line he gives short shrift the immensely expensive and technically complex challenge of building the A-bomb. Nor does Mr. Kennedy mention that when HST hinted to Stalin that America had an powerful new weapon Stalin was all ready aware of the activities going on at Trinity and of the Manhattan Project. Mr. Kennedy doesn't offer any new information or insights but this is a good, one-book overview, of the war.
